#4fffdc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4fffdc is composed of 31% red, 100%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.7%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 168.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 65.5%. #4fffdc color hex could be obtained by blending #9effff with #00ffb9.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#4fffdc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4fffdc has RGB values of R:79, G:255,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.14, K:0. Its decimal value is 5242844.
